Buying Guide

When looking at under-desk mounts like this, you need to think about what you're actually putting in it. The big deal isn't just 'will it hold it,' but 'will it *fit* it.' You're drilling into your desk, so you want to get it right the first time. Make sure your device's height and weight are within the mount's limits, otherwise, you're just making holes for nothing.

Weight Capacity (35 lbs / 15.8 kg)

This tells you the maximum weight the mount can safely support. If your NAS or mini PC is heavier, the mount could bend or fail, potentially damaging your expensive gear.

Adjustable Height Range (10.7 cm-20.4 cm / 4.2"-8")

This is crucial for compatibility. Your device's height must fall within this range for it to be securely held. If it's too tall, it won't fit; if it's too short, it might not be snug.

Material (High-density steel)

The material dictates the mount's strength and durability. Steel is generally sturdy, meaning it's less likely to flex or break under its rated load compared to plastic alternatives.
